How should this product be used?
Gently place the tip of the brush onto the powder, picking up a small amount and knocking off any excess (if necessary). Stroke over face using short, downward strokes, following the natural contours of the face. For the smoothest finish, avoid applying powder in a brisk back-and-forth or up-and-down motion.

How many brushes do I need?
Your choice of brushes is determined by how you apply your makeup. An elaborate, nuanced makeup application would typically involve a variety of brushes. Conversely, a minimal and/or basic makeup application requires fewer brushes. The general rule to follow is that the size of the brush should match (or correspond with) the size of the area you are working on. It is best to avoid using the same brush for applying both lighter and darker colors.
When should I replace my brushes?
Replace them if they become misshapen, frayed, or start shedding excessively, or if the brush handle becomes loose or splintered.
